SUIT WITH VEST NEW MEASUREMENTS
Measure around the chest where it is largest, right across the nipples. Breathe normally. Note that this measurement should be taken with a finger inside the measuring tape.
Chest :
(inch)
Measure around the stomach, in line with the navel. Breathe normally. Note that this measurement should be taken with a finger inside the measuring tape.
Waist :
(inch)
Measure around the widest part of the bicep. Let your arm hang down by your side. This measurement should be taken with a finger inside the measuring tape.
Bicep :
(inch)
Think of a line going from your armpit straight upwards to your shoulder. Measure between those two points and hold the tape measure straight.
Shoulder :
(inch)
Measure around the fullest part of your hips.
Jacket Hips :
(inch)
From the outermost edge of the shoulder, same point as the shoulder measurement, measure down to the start of the thumb. The arm should hang straight down.
Sleeve Length :
(inch)
Start at the middle of the shoulder. Starting point is the shoulder seam of your jacket. Measure straight down to the middle of the thumb, or where you want the jacket to end. Breathe normally.
Jacket Length :
(inch)
It should be taken where you want your trousers to rest and should be taken first, as some measurements use the waist point as a starting point.
Trousers Waist :
(inch)
The buttock measurement is taken where the buttocks are at their largest. Note that this measurement should be taken with a finger inside the measuring tape.
Trousers Hips :
(inch)
It should be taken level with the lowest point of the U-measurement. At this point, measure around the thigh. It will be taken with a finger inside the measuring tape.
Trousers Thighs :
(inch)
Measure from the desired waistline in the front to the desired waistline in the back. If in doubt about the tightness of this measurement, take it while wearing a pair of trousers that fit you.
Trousers Crotch :
(inch)
This measurement is taken at the bottom of the trousers leg. Note that this measurement should give the circumference of the trouser leg, not your ankle
Trousers Cuffs :
(inch)
Measure on the outside of the leg. Start at the desired waist level and measure from this point down to where you want the trousers to end. We strongly recommend taking this measurement with shoes on
Trousers Length :
(inch)

SUIT WITH VEST FROM CLOTHING MEASUREMENTS
1. Chest :
(inch)
Lay the jacket flat and buttoned, measure from the left seam to the right seam just below the armhole, then multiply this measurement by 2.
2. Jacket Wist :
(inch)
Lay the jacket flat and buttoned, measure from the left seam to the right seam at the narrowest part of the waistline, multiply this measurement by 2.
3. Hip :
(inch)
Lay the jacket flat and buttoned, measure from the left seam to the right seam at the position about 16cm above the bottom edge, multiply this measurement by 2.
4. Front Length :
(inch)
Lay the jacket flat, measure from the yoke (where the shoulder plate meets the collar) straight down to the bottom edge.
5. Back Length :
(inch)
Lay the jacket flat, measure from the middle of the back collar seam straight down to the bottom edge.
6. Shoulder :
(inch)
Wear the jacket, measure across the top of the shoulder between the arm seams. Make sure to take the curved contour and pass the point about 1cm straight below the center of the back collar.
7. Bicep :
(inch)
Measure the width of the sleeve at the upper arm position, multiply this measurement by 2.
8. Sleeve Length Right :
(inch)
Make sure to lay the sleeve flat, measure from shoulder-sleeve joint to the end of the cuff.
8. Sleeve Length Left :
(inch)
Make sure to lay the sleeve flat, measure from shoulder-sleeve joint to the end of the cuff.
9. Cuff :
(inch)
Lay the cuff flat, measure from the left seam to the right seam, multiply this measurement by 2.
10. Back Width :
(inch)
Make sure to lay the jacket flat and buttoned, measure horizontally from the left sleeve seam to the right sleeve seam.
1. Waist :
(inch)
Lay the trousers flat and buttoned, measure from the left seam to the right seam at the middle of the waistband, then multiply this measurement by 2.
2. Hip :
(inch)
Lay the trousers flat and buttoned, measure from the point 2cm above the bottom of front opening vertically to the left and right side of the outseams, then multiply the measurements by 2.
3. Pants Outseam :
(inch)
Lay the trousers flat, measure from the top of the waistband straight down to the end of the bottom.
4. Inseam :
(inch)
Lay the trousers flat, measure from the crotch straight down to the end of the bottom.
5. Thigh :
(inch)
Lay the trousers flat, measure from the bottom of the crotch to the right seam, multiply this measurement by 2.
6. Knee :
(inch)
Lay the trousers flat, measure from the left seam to the right seam at the position around 6 cm above half inseam, multiply this measurement by 2.
7. Bottom :
(inch)
Lay the trousers flat, measure from the left seam to the right seam at the bottom edge, multiply this measurement by 2.
8. Crotch :
(inch)
Lay the trousers flat, measure from the top of the waistband straight down to the bottom of the crotch, multiply this measurement by 2.
